Hi, I want to calculate as follow:
Minus "Value" for each bucket with "Value" from bucket 1 group by "Division"
| Division | Bucket | Value | Dif |
A | 1 | 7 | 0 (7 - 7) |
| A | 2 | 8 | 1 (8 - 7) |
| A | 3 | 9 | 2 (9 - 7) |
| B | 1 | 10 | 0 (10 - 10) |
| B | 2 | 13 | 3 (12 - 10) |
| B | 3 | 15 | 5 (15 - 10) |

@AN2021
Try this code please:
Difference =
Table3[Value]
-
CALCULATE(
sum(Table3[Value]),
Table3[Bucket] = 1,
ALLEXCEPT(Table3,Table3[Division])
)

Try the following measure:
Measure3 =
VAR __bucket1 =
CALCULATE (
SUM ( Sheet1[Value] ),
FILTER ( ALLEXCEPT ( Sheet1, Sheet1[Division] ), Sheet1[Bucket] = 1 )
)
RETURN
SUM ( Sheet1[Value] ) - __bucket1
